Output 66e6f175c5092fd29c3a6f06e75403610c18a85b1042e49b3564d53ced31b53b:0

value
2632641
script pubkey
OP_0 OP_PUSHBYTES_20 c6d37d6ca85322ab41e2de4172f57060ce7d32fa
address
bc1qcmfh6m9g2v32ks0zmeqh9atsvr886vh6pmrwrp
transaction
66e6f175c5092fd29c3a6f06e75403610c18a85b1042e49b3564d53ced31b53b
spent
true